Keeneland Sets New Record for Yearling Sale

Published September 20th, 2005


Keeneland surpassed its own world record for gross receipts in a single thoroughbred auction Monday at its September Yearling Sale.The purchase of a colt by the sire Officer, out of the broodmare Prim Flower, for $45,000 by Excel Bloodstock, LLC brought the sale’s total gross to $324,927,500. The record was broken during the auction’s seventh day, 2,216 horses into the 5,110-horse catalog for the sale, which runs through Sept. 26.

Last year, Keeneland set the former record during its 14-day September sale, selling 3,370 horses for $324,904,300.
